Keith Fuchs and Baruch Ben-Yosef aka Andy Green are 2 of the 3 FBI longest active fugitives.
It's absolutely wild how not 20/20, 48hrs, Dateline, or even Americas Most Wanted have done an episode on them, considering they both are wanted for murder of Alex Odeh.
Alex Odeh was American killed on American soil. He was Christian, scheduled to speak at a synagogue to preach unity between Jews, Christians, and Muslims, the same day he was murdered via bomb.
The JDL are a domestic terrorist organization that Fuchs and Ben-Yosef were a part of. Bombs were their #1 method of choice, and the FBI had them 2 as well as Robert Manning as a suspect.
The story gets deep, and kind of mysterious. Each have a $1,000,000 active bounty. Each of their locations are known. FBI and DOJ don't seem to be doing as much as they can to get justice for an American who was so revered, they made a statue of him.
